PMI R.E.P.s are educational organizations that have demonstrated their ability to provide world-class, effective project management training. Through PMI’s rigorous quality criteria for course content, instructor qualification, and instructional design, R.E.P.s provide the project management training necessary to earn and to maintain Project Management Professional (PMP)®, Program Management Professional (PgMP)® and other PMI professional credentials.

“PMI’s recent survey of training providers shows that 80 percent of organizations seeking suppliers of project management training strongly prefer to work with PMI R.E.P.s. They view their affiliation with PMI, the leading standard-setting professional association for project management, as a stamp of quality on the training services they purchase,” said Edwin Andrews, Ph.D., director of academic and educational programs and services at PMI. “Organizations want to protect their investment in project management training, and they know that a PMI R.E.P. delivers such training in a cost-effective and efficient manner.”

Currently, there are over 1,400 R.E.P.s in more than 70 countries. These organizations include commercial training providers that design complete educational systems, academic institutions, internal training offices at corporations and government agencies.

About Project Management Institute (PMI)

PMI is the world’s largest project management member association, representing more than half a million practitioners in over 185 countries. As a global thought leader and knowledge resource, PMI advances the profession through its global standards and credentials, collaborative chapters and virtual communities and academic research.
